Mental Health Training Requirements
Training programs vary for mental health careers. However, an
associate or bachelors degree in psychology is required for most
positions. Training consists of coursework in medical and physiological
terminology, abnormal psychology, gerontology, counseling, personality,
and other psychology related topics. Training programs also require an
internship related to psychology or mental health. Individuals with
undergraduate degrees can attain positions as assistant counselors or
mental health assistants or technicians. Individuals with advanced
training and degrees are eligible for other lucrative careers such as
therapy, psychiatry, neurology, and counseling. These careers require
much more training within the specialization with intense course work
and internship requirements.

Mental Health Training, Certification and Degree Programs
Most mental health careers require a background education in
psychology. Depending on the type of career chosen, training can take
anywhere from one to ten years. Mental health professionals deal with
many different types of patients and mental illnesses including
depression, substance abuse, and other psychological disorders. Most
mental health professionals work as counselors or therapists to help
prevent and treat mental health issues.
Depending on the mental health career, there are many different
levels of certification. For mental health assistants, an associate
degree or higher in psychology is usually sufficient to work in a mental
health facility. Other advanced degrees require board certification and
licensure in order to practice.
Mental Health Prerequisites
Though the prerequisites of colleges and schools throughout the
United States vary, most will require a high school diploma or
equivalent with two years of mathematics and one year of laboratory
chemistry or biology for undergraduate degrees. For advanced masters or
doctoral level degrees, further education and training is required.
Various schools and colleges offer flexible course schedules that range
